The Bug type was the most common 4× weakness in Generation I, with 11 Pokémon doubly weak to it, mainly due to Poison type having a weakness to it at the time. Prior to Generation 6, Ghost / Dark had zero weaknesses; with the introduction of Fairy this is no longer the case..
